Roberto makes a paper mouse at school and becomes curious about what exactly the mouse does! That night while everyone else dreams it is said that Roberto does not. Instead he sees a cat trapped in a box by a dog. Suddenly the paper house starts fall down and the shadow scares the dog away. Imaginantion and creativeness plays a major role in this story! The dreams that everyone were having were represented by all kinds of different colors swirling around in each window. I thought that was a very clever way to show who was dreaming and who wasn't. I think this book would be a good bedtime story because it's fun and short and might get kids excited to go to sleep so they can dream too. no reviews | add a review
